lib/hara.rb in hara-0.3.0 vs lib/hara.rb in hara-0.4.0
- old
+ new
@@ -2,15 +2,14 @@
module Hara
class << self
#decode message, return action and args
def decode_msg msg
- msg = JSON.parse(msg)
- msg.values_at 'action', 'args'
+ JSON.parse msg
end
- def encode_msg action, *args
- {action: action, args: args}.to_json
+ def encode_msg msg
+ msg.to_json
end
def filter_class
@filter_class || DefaultFilter
end